Why Hinuera stone needs specialist care
Hinuera stone is a premium, natural material that gives homes and buildings a unique, elegant finish. But it’s also soft and porous, which means it requires expert cleaning methods. Unfortunately, most general house washing companies simply don’t have the training or tools to treat it safely.
Many homeowners assume standard exterior cleaning is suitable for Hinuera stone—and that’s where the trouble starts.
The risks of using general house washers to clean your Hinuera stone home

Water blasting Hinuera causes irreversible damage
Most house washing services rely on high-pressure water blasting. On Hinuera stone, this leads to:
-
Permanent texture damage
-
Surface erosion
-
Etching and scarring
-
Loss of natural protective layers
-
Waterblasting drives black mould deeper into the pores of the stone.
-
Once the stone is damaged, it cannot be repaired.

Incorrect chemicals can stain or burn Hinuera stone
Many off-the-shelf cleaners and standard house washing products react badly with Hinuera. This can cause:
-
Yellowing or discolouration
-
Chemical burns
-
Patchy, uneven finishes
-
Some cleaning companies mistakenly use bleach or chlorine products, leading to white stains on the stone.

No proper advice on long-term maintenance
Most builders and cleaning companies don’t explain how to maintain Hinuera stone. For homeowners, this often leads to mould, lichen, staining, and unnecessary long-term costs.

The importance of sealing Hinuera stone
Cleaning is only the first step. Sealing your Hinuera stone is essential for long-term protection.
-
Creates a moisture barrier that prevents water from sitting in the pores and reduces mould growth.
-
Prevents mould, moss, and lichen growth
-
Stops staining and moisture absorption
-
Retains natural colour
-
Extends the stone’s lifespan — this helps prevent deterioration of stonework when the full maintenance programme is followed.
-
Unsealed Hinuera becomes increasingly difficult to clean each year. Sealing protects your home and keeps it looking new.

Frequently asked questions
What is the safest way to clean Hinuera stone?
The safest method is specialist no-pressure cleaning using products designed specifically for Hinuera stone.
What products should I use to clean Hinuera stone?
Only approved, stone-safe treatments should be used. Many common exterior cleaners can stain or burn Hinuera stone.
Can I water blast Hinuera stone?
No. Water blasting causes irreversible surface damage, scarring, and erosion.
Why is my Hinuera stone going green?
Its porous nature allows moisture to sit in the stone, leading to mould, moss, and lichen growth.
How often should Hinuera stone be cleaned?
With proper sealing, most properties only need gentle maintenance every 12–24 months.
Do I need to seal Hinuera stone after cleaning?
Yes. Sealing protects against moisture, staining, mould growth, and future deterioration.
Is Hinuera stone cleaning more expensive than house washing?
Specialist cleaning costs more upfront because it requires expert care—but it prevents long-term damage and costly repairs.
Can general house washing chemicals damage Hinuera stone?
Yes. Most people do not understand the unique make up Hinuera stone and don't under the effects of the chemicals they are applying. Many over-the-counter and commercial cleaners like pool chlorine react negatively with Hinuera stone.
How long does professional Hinuera stone cleaning take?
This process varies depending on the stone areas and what needs to be protected in the cleaning process. Depending on the size and level of contamination—typically one to three days.
